Surrogate time series

T Schreiber, A Schmitz�- Physica D: Nonlinear Phenomena, 2000 - Elsevier
Before we apply nonlinear techniques, eg those inspired by chaos theory, to dynamical
phenomena occurring in nature, it is necessary to first ask if the use of such advanced
techniques is justified by the data. While many processes in nature seem very unlikely a
priori to be linear, the possible nonlinear nature might not be evident in specific aspects of
their dynamics. The method of surrogate data has become a very popular tool to address
such a question. However, while it was meant to provide a statistically rigorous, foolproof�…
